President Javier Milei preferred to put aside the hot problems faced by the government, following the raids that took place on Friday in the cause of the alleged coimas in the area of Disability, and focused his speech on the economic concepts that he used to display, with a purely technical vision. President Javier Milei presented himself on the anniversary of the Bolsa de Comercio de Rosario where he finally broke the silence in the midst of the scandal over the audios of the former head of the National Disability Agency (ANDIS), Diego Spagnuolo, but chose not to say anything about it.
